Holidays with Hayne: Ste(a)m Gift Ideas

It’s that time of year again when our to-do list grows longer and the calendar gets filled up with holiday events, so getting our shopping done early is a MUST! We have put together some of our favorite ste(a)m (Science, Technology, Engineering, Arts, and Math) gifts for our future architects (or scientists, engineers, mathematicians, etc.).

One. Manhattan Toy Skwish Rattle

This molecular-style rattle is perfect for the baby on your list! We prefer it in the natural wood finish but it also comes in different colors.

Two. The Modern Cloth Company’s ABC Cloth

Let your kiddos color and recolor these fun, portable, and machine-washable coloring cloths. We like this ABC one, but you can find different patterns to suit any kid on your gift list this year!

Five. Kiwi Co Crates

These activity crates are available in age ranges from 0 to 12+ in a variety of areas of interest. You can get a subscription or an individual crate for the kid on your shopping list.
